When exploring the idea of getting a pink quad for your child, several critical factors deserve careful attention. 

 

  1. Parents should take into account their child's age and physical size. Pink quad bikes come in a range of sizes and models, so it's vital to select one that perfectly suits your child's dimensions and weight. Equally significant is ensuring that your child has reached an appropriate age for safe riding.

 

  1. Children under the age of six should not be allowed to ride quad bikes. For those between the ages of six and twelve, it's crucial to limit them to bikes specifically designed for their age group to ensure their safety and enjoyment. This thoughtful consideration will contribute to a positive and secure experience with the pink quad.

 

  1. Parents should prioritize evaluating the safety features integrated into the pink quad bike. Look out for essential safety components, including but not limited to a conspicuous safety flag, a speed limiter, and the convenience of a remote control for parental oversight. Incorporating these features into your choice of a quad bike can significantly diminish the potential risks of accidents and injuries while your child enjoys their ride.

 

  1. It's crucial to select a quad bike that is designed with the child's ease of operation and maneuverability in mind. Opt for quad bikes equipped with straightforward controls and a well-balanced, low center of gravity. These design elements can greatly enhance a child's ability to manage the bike effectively and help prevent any mishaps during their riding adventures.

 

  1. When acquiring a pink quad for their child, parents should also take into account the quad bike's quality and resilience. Opt for quads constructed from top-notch materials and renowned for their robustness. This ensures that the quad bike will have a long lifespan, offering countless hours of joy for the child.
